France and Germany criticize Israel’s hospital attack
French President Emmanuel Macron described Israel’s attack on Nasser Hospital as “unacceptable,” according to a post on X. “The media must be able to carry out its work freely and independently to report the reality of the conflict,” Macron wrote. “A permanent ceasefire, release of hostages, large-scale delivery of humanitarian aid, and a lasting political solution that includes the disarmament of Hamas are necessary,” he added. An Israeli raid on Al-Nasser Hospital in Khan Younis in the Gaza Strip, which killed at least 20 people, including five journalists working for global news agencies such as Reuters, Associated Press, and Al Jazeera, triggered a wave of international condemnations by world leaders and press organizations. The President of France, Emmanuel Macron, described the attack on Nasser Hospital in the southern Gaza Strip by the Israeli Army on Monday as "intolerable," resulting in the deaths of four journalists and another ten people, in a telephone conversation he had with the emir of Qatar, Tamim bin Hamad al Thani, who had claimed that the victims were "unarmed innocent civilians."
